Transaction aa6654150e40e5610a99505769dc70aa3613958c6fbb6af3905b156b5f9c3069
2 Input
2 Outputs
- aa6654150e40e5610a99505769dc70aa3613958c6fbb6af3905b156b5f9c3069:0
- aa6654150e40e5610a99505769dc70aa3613958c6fbb6af3905b156b5f9c3069:1
value 160500000
address 19TkXaiYxCMi4WtrPRJ4TDjHzsx39HrBwF
value 2896176723
address 12C3WZ5HHgg6ETZRsqyhT4Khqpcsi87vSs